Black leather dye, forget the make but a search should throw it up.  @NancyJohnson did a post about it a few years ago and I tried it - worked a treat.

 

Yup, Fiebings Leather Dye.  Black.  Mask off your nut/binding, make sure the fingerboard is finish/varnish-free and clean (I'd already been using lemon oil, the board wasn't grimy).  Oh, wear gloves. 

 

Apply the dye with a Q-Tip, and do smallish areas, let the dye set up for about 30 seconds and wipe off any excess.  I was a little concerned about the inlay dots on the neck as it's almost impossible to go round them...i was easily able to clean off the dye on top of the dots with a Q-Tip dipped in some methylated spirit.

 

Obviously I was concerned.  Christ, it was a £4.5k bass.  The results were very much what I wanted and there's been little dulling of the board since I did it.
